I’m on Windows 10 and am having the same problem… Used to work perfectly, I didn’t update it but it stays forever stuck in “We’re signing you in to your account”.
I have tried changing call arguments to -OpenCL, uninstalling, reinstalling, changing from Google DNS to OpenCloud DNS, …

What more is there to do?

After I deleted almost all configuration I could find in AppData, it asked me for login credentials. After entering email and password it asked for the confirmation code sent to e-mail (2FA). I entered a stale one and it did complain (so it does have a connection). Then I entered the new 2FA code and same problem now occurs: stuck at “We’re signing you in to your account” (but now in my System language instead of english since I’ve deleted config files).

I have followed the Networking troubleshooting (open ports @ windows firewall), I have uninstalled, reinstalled multiple times. After deleting all configurations in AppData I finally got the login page. After I enter my credentials it get’s stuck on “We’re signing you in to your account”. I have tried fixing the installation also, that does the same as clearing the settings in AppData, allows me to see the login page but after entering credentials it stays stuck. It does have connectivity because it recognizes if I input a stale 2FA code or the correct one - once the correct one is inserted, guess what? Stuck login screen.
I have tried contacting support but they clearly didn’t read a thing I wrote and told me that to play fortnite I should update GPU drivers and open my firewall - I use the launcher to manage Unreal Engine installations and assets, I never mentioned anything about fortnite.
If I use the launcher in offline mode it opens, shows the versions of Unreal Engine I have installed, lets me browse the marketplace, but as soon as I click “sign in” I get stuck login once again.

I think I had the same issue to you and fixed it by doing these things

  1. Uninstalled Hamachi VPN
  2. Uninstalled Radmin VPN
  3. Uninstalled Radmin Server Viewer
  4. Changed my Epic Games password on the website

not sure if they are all necessary or only 1 of them but it has fixed for me so try that
